Cabinet material selection remains a core determinant of pricing. Natural hardwoods like maple, oak, and cherry provide longevity and elegant finishes but command premium prices relative to MDF or plywood alternatives. Wood varieties present unique aesthetics and performance: maple’s fine grain suits modern layouts, whereas oak’s rich texture complements classic interiors. Engineered wood alternatives, while more affordable, often provide a wide range of finishes and colors but may lack the longevity and strength of natural hardwoods. Awareness of these material nuances empowers homeowners to achieve harmony between cost-efficiency and design vision.

Cabinet construction techniques play a crucial role in both durability and pricing. Frameless cabinets, common in modern European-style kitchens, offer sleek lines and maximize interior storage, but require precise craftsmanship and often come at a higher cost. Face-frame cabinets, more traditional in style, provide structural reinforcement and easier installation, sometimes making them a more budget-friendly option without sacrificing quality. Additionally, joinery methods such as dovetailing or mortise-and-tenon joints increase production costs but deliver exceptional durability, ensuring cabinets can withstand daily use for decades.

Professional installation expenses can be a significant yet overlooked portion of cabinet costs. Proper installation guarantees alignment, structural integrity, and long-lasting performance, regardless of cabinet quality. Misaligned doors, uneven surfaces, or poorly fitted drawers can compromise both functionality and aesthetic appeal. Depending on the complexity of the design and kitchen layout, labor costs can range significantly, sometimes equaling the price of the cabinets themselves.
